Assisted living costs in Austin average about $5,842 per month. To find the best assisted living options for your needs and budget, browse through 50 communities in Austin. Our detailed directory has 571 reviews, photos, and lists of available services, amenities, and activities. Assisted living is ideal for seniors who need help with activities of daily living, such as bathing and eating, and prefer a social setting to pursue their interests. These communities offer a variety of dining options, as well as housekeeping services to eliminate daily stresses.

Cost of assisted living in Austin, NY

The average cost of senior living in Austin is $5,842 per month. Cheaper nearby regions include Clyde, NY with an average of $4,547 per month.

Community typeAustin, NYNew YorkU.S.
Assisted Living$5,842/mo$5,841/mo$4,705/mo
Memory Care$5,710/mo$5,929/mo$4,954/mo
Independent Living$4,331/mo$4,694/mo$4,160/mo

The table below shows how monthly assisted living costs in Austin have changed in the last two years and how those changes compare with state and national trends. The figures represent averages of actual costs paid by seniors who moved into A Place for Mom partner communities in 2023 and 2024.

Cost comparison table showing 2023 and 2024 median costs by location. This table contains 3 rows of data across 4 columns.
Column location: Location
Column cost2024: 2024 average cost
Column cost2023: 2023 average cost
Column percentChange: Percent change
Location2024 average cost2023 average costPercent change
Austin, NY$5,398/mo$4,885/mo+10.5%
New York$6,714/mo$6,394/mo+5.0%
National$5,375/mo$5,129/mo+4.8%

State regulations for assisted living in Austin

Safety is a primary concern when seniors and their families look for assisted living. Each state has its own laws and inspection processes to help ensure seniors reside in a safe environment and receive quality care. Learning about New York assisted living regulations will help you understand how assisted living communities in Austin protect seniors.
